Abstract
A recent dirty-limit version of the Gor'kov theory is used to calculate numerically the self-consistent structure and free energy of isolated vortices and of the vortex lattice in the circular cell approximation at arbitrary temperature and Ginzburg-Landau parameter κ. This yields the lower critical fieldH c1, the magnetization curve, the electronic specific heat, and the density of states at the Fermi surface. The results are discussed and compared with experiments.
